ECHL: Jacksonville Transactions 3/19/2024

The Jacksonville Icemen have announced many player movements this week. Jacksonville has obtained Brandon Puricelli in a trade with the Cincinnati Cyclones. This trade completed the future considerations the team made with Cincinnati following the trade terms of the November 21st trade. Nick Isaacson of the Jacksonville Icemen was sent to Cincinnati. 

Puricelli joined the Jacksonville Icemen following this season, playing with both Cincinnati and the Allen Americans. Puricelli played a combined 56 games, accumulating for 20 points through nine goals and 11 assists. 

The Icemen have also announced that goaltender Michael Houser has been recalled by Rochester Americans. Forward Brendan Harris has been placed on loan to the AHL’s organization, Cleveland Monsters. Harris has played in 58 games this season with the Icemen. He has scored 19 times and tallied 57 assists this season. Harris currently leads the Icemen organization in points and assists and is ranked third on the team for goals. Houser has played in 23 games this season, combining for a 10 – 10 win/loss record. Houser has had 2 shut-out games, one of which came from Sunday’s game against the Greenville Swamp Rabbits on March 17th. Houser also has a 0.907 save percentage on the year. 

The Jacksonville Icemen will be back at home this week. They will face the Trois-Rivieres Lions on Wednesday, March 20th at 7 pm. Following that, they will face the Greenville Swamp Rabbits back at home, on Friday, March 22nd, and Saturday, March 23rd. Both games will be played at 7 pm.
